STL looks into trial in absentia on Friday
The STL first instance chamber will hold a public hearing on Friday to look into the possibility of holding a trial in absentia for the four Hezbollah members indicted in former PM Rafik Hariri’s assassination.   

Judge Robert Ross heads the first instance chamber while judges Micheline Breidy and David Ray are members. Representatives from the prosecution and the defense office that is opposing the trail in absentia will also be present.

In fact, the defense office considers that such a trial would be unfair while the prosecution is asking for more time to understand the reasons why the accused have not yet been captured.     

During Friday’s hearing, both sides will present their cases verbally but the appealable final decision will not yet be taken.
